Product reviews:
Moses
2026-01-20 iphone 11 Pro Max
XLARGE 17'' SHAGGY LLAMA PLUSH. NEW large llama stuffed animal
large llama stuffed animal
Stanley
2026-01-16 iphone 7 Plus
Crochet llama llama stuffed animal large llama stuffed animal
large llama stuffed animal
Large STUFFED ALPACA Llama large llama stuffed animal
large llama stuffed animal
Rachel
2026-01-18 iphone X
Wholesale 2.5' Melissa Doug Large Llama large llama stuffed animal
large llama stuffed animal